7IM announces that its Pathbuilder multi-asset fund range has reached a major milestone of over £1bn in assets under management, having recently marked its fifth anniversary.
Launched in 2020, the Pathbuilder range was developed in response to growing adviser demand for low-cost, globally diversified portfolios aligned to clearly defined risk profiles. Five years on, the range has established itself as a compelling ‘passive’ solution combining cost efficiency with a thoughtful long-term approach to diversification.
Unlike traditional passive strategies that rely heavily on market-capitalisation weighting, Pathbuilder is built on 7IM’s Strategic Asset Allocation (SAA) framework. This approach allows for annual updates and selective adjustments to asset classes where appropriate, ensuring portfolios remain aligned with long-term investment horizons and avoid short-term tactical positioning.
Since launch, this philosophy has enabled the funds to keep pace with, or outperform, its peers, despite a period dominated by strong US equity performance. By taking a more balanced approach to diversification, including allocations to areas such as emerging market bonds, the range has delivered consistent returns without taking on excessive risk.
In 2024, 7IM enhanced the Pathbuilder range by introducing a medium-term ‘trend following’ strategy, accounting for up to 4% of each portfolio. This addition is designed to provide further diversification by capturing opportunities in both rising and falling markets, which can be helpful for the portfolio when other return seeking assets are not performing well.
Fund performance since launch
- Pathbuilder 1, the lowest-risk fund with £56.6m AUM, has delivered 21.08% growth since launch.[1] Launched 09/12/2020.
- Pathbuilder 2, the balanced fund with £286.7 AUM, has returned 39.81%, outperforming the IA 20–60% Shares sector by 10.97%. Launched 09/12/2020.
- Pathbuilder 3, with £310.6m AUM, has achieved 56.57% growth, outperforming the IA 40–85% Shares sector by 14.15%. Launched 09/12/2020.
- Pathbuilder 4, the highest-risk option and largest fund at £399.6m AUM, has returned 53.69% since launch and is approaching its five-year anniversary. 03/12/2021.
The funds maintain a low annual management charge of 0.22% and are available via the 7IM Platform and a wide range of adviser platforms.
